Finance review summary — for sales leads. The proposed joint venture with Tarnwell Fabrication would combine our distribution network with their coating capacity under a new entity, Bridgeline Surfaces. Modelled returns break even in year two, assuming current order volumes hold. Capital commitment is within approved limits. Sales territories would be unaffected during the transition. The review committee meets Thursday. A confidential planning note is appended directly below.

confidential, fahag-yahap: Project Raleth slips by six weeks because of the tooling delay.

The per-tenant rate quota setting formerly called TENANT_LIMIT is now QUOTA_CEILING_PER_TENANT in the Millbrook gateway. Old configs keep working until 5.0 but log a deprecation warning on boot, so expect tickets about log noise. Values carry over unchanged; no unit conversion is needed. When helping customers migrate, have them rename the key in gateway.env, restart, and confirm the warning is gone. Migrated configs must also re-declare the quota service credential, which goes on the line immediately after the renamed setting:

vault entry, bajop-bahop: COURIER_KEY3=915

# Gridbench Environments

Bulk edits in the Gridbench admin table run against prod, staging, and the Cinderpool sandbox. Only staging allows unreviewed bulk writes. If a bulk edit misbehaves, pause the job queue first, then revert via the audit log. Sandbox resets nightly. Each environment reads the values below at boot.

settings of yageg-yahap:
[gorael]
team = olieth
access_code = ac_941d74
owner = brieth.aldiel
host = gorael.tolvaqio.internal
port = 6379
peer = briwyn.urlaqtech.internal
salt = 116e6622
pin = 1957